公开(公告)号:CA3031948A1
公开(公告)日:2018-02-01
申请号:CA3031948
申请日:2017-07-27
Applicant: HONEYWELL INT INC
Inventor: PETERSEN MICHAEL , VERA BECERRA ELIZABET DEL CARMEN , YANA MOTTA SAMUEL F , SETHI ANKIT , POTTKER GUSTAVO , SMITH GREGORY LAURENCE , ZOU YANG
Abstract: Disclosed are refrigerants comprising at least about 97% by weight of a blend of three compounds, said blend consisting of: from about 38% by weight to about 48% by weight difluoromethane (HFC-32), from about 6% by weight to about 12% by weight pentafluoroethane (HFC-125), from about 33% by weight to about 41 % by weight trifluoroiodomethane (CF3I) and from about 2% by weight to about 16% by weight 2,3,3,3-tetrafluoropropene (HFO-1234yf) wherein the percentages are based on the total weight of the three compounds in the blend, and methods and systems which use same.

公开(公告)号:CA3032010A1
公开(公告)日:2018-02-01
申请号:CA3032010
申请日:2017-07-27
Applicant: HONEYWELL INT INC
Inventor: SETHI ANKIT , YANA MOTTA SAMUEL F , POTTKER GUSTAVO , SMITH GREGORY LAURENCE , VERA BECERRA ELIZABET DEL CARMEN , ZOU YANG , CLOSE JOSHUA
Abstract: Disclosed are refrigerants comprising at least about 97% by weight of a blend of three compounds, said blend consisting of: from about 40% by weight to about 49% by weight difluoromethane (HFC-32), from about 6% by weight to about 12% by weight pentafluoroethane (HFC-125), from about 33% by weight to about 40% by weight trifluoroiodomethane (CF3I); and from about 2% by weight to about 12% by weight of trans 1,3,3,3-tetrafluoropropene (trans HFO-1234ze), wherein the percentages are based on the total weight of the three compounds in the blend, and systems and method using same.

公开(公告)号:CA3062327A1
公开(公告)日:2018-11-08
申请号:CA3062327
申请日:2018-05-04
Applicant: HONEYWELL INT INC
Inventor: ZOU YANG , YANA MOTTA SAMUEL F , POTTKER GUSTAVO , SETHI ANKIT , VERA BECERRA ELIZABET DEL CARMEN , TANGRI HENNA
Abstract: Disclosed are heat transfer compositions and methods and systems containing refrigerants consisting essentially of difluoromethane (HFC-32), and trifluoroiodomethane (CF3I), and heat transfer compositions and methods and systems containing refrigerants consisting essentially of difluoromethane (HFC-32), and trifluoroiodomethane (CF3I) and CO2.
